Balsamic Vinaigrette (8 Servings)

INGREDIENTS 1 small shallot (or one lobe of a large shallot), peeled, cored, and quartered ⅓ cup extra-virgin olive oil ¼ cup balsamic vinegar 1 teaspoons Dijon mustard 2 teaspoons honey Salt to taste ¼ teaspoon freshly ground pepper

INSTRUCTIONS 1. Purée shallot, oil, vinegar, mustard, honey, salt and pepper in a blender until smooth, about 30 seconds. 2. Use immediately or store in a sealed jar in the refrigerator up to 1 week. Bring to room temperature before serving, if it becomes solid.

Carrot Ginger Dressing (8 Servings)

INGREDIENTS 1 ½ cups carrots, chopped (1 large or 2 small carrots) ⅔ to 1 cup water ½ cup extra-virgin olive oil, plus more for drizzling ¼ cup rice vinegar 1 tablespoon chopped fresh ginger or ginger paste

INSTRUCTIONS 1. Preheat the oven to 400°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per. 2. Toss the carrots with olive oil and spread evenly on the baking sheet. Roast for 20 – 25 minutes, or until the carrots are soft. 3. Transfer the cooked carrots to a blender and add ⅔ cup water, olive oil, vinegar, ginger, and salt. Blend the dressing until smooth. If the dressing is too thick, add up to ⅓ cup more water and blend again. 4. Chill the dressing in the refrigerator until ready to use.
